My acid reflux only strikes at night. Nothing quite like waking up and having to swallow the contents of your stomach very quickly…*ugh* Not being a fan of taking lots of pills here’s my ‘do it yourself’ fixes. Now, if it’s a really bad attack, I take a Zantac.
Here’s what I do:
If it’s mild, sleep on your left side. The curvature of your stomach makes it so that your less likely to have an attack that way. If the attack is severe enough….
Sleep sitting up. Or as inclined as you are comfortable with. I will put several pillows into a wedge shape and sleep like that. It usually does the trick.
My friend’s son had really bad reflux, she would elevate his cot matress by placing a pillow under one side. Did the trick for her.
